About Vartan
Vartan carries an ancient resonance, a name steeped in Armenian history and faith, meaning “giver of roses.” It’s a choice for parents who appreciate a strong, noble sound with deep cultural roots, far from fleeting trends. Unlike many historical names that feel dusty, Vartan remains remarkably fresh and robust, perhaps due to its straightforward sound and the enduring legacy of figures like Vartan Mamikonian, a revered military leader. This name offers a unique blend of strength and poetic beauty, suggesting a child who is both resilient and thoughtful, connected to a rich heritage yet distinctly individual.

Famous People Named Vartan
- Vartan Mamikonian (c. 387–451), Armenian military leader and saint
- Vartan Gregorian (1934–2021), Armenian-American academic, historian, and philanthropist
- Vartan Malakian (born 1963), Armenian-American artist and father of Daron Malakian from System of a Down
- Vartan Oskanian (born 1955), Armenian politician and former Foreign Minister of Armenia

Frequently Asked Questions About Vartan
What are the cultural associations of the name Vartan?
Vartan is deeply associated with Armenian history and the Armenian Apostolic Church, notably through figures like Vartan Mamikonian. It evokes a strong sense of cultural heritage and faith.
Is Vartan a popular name?
Vartan is most popular in Armenia, reflecting its specific cultural origins. It is a distinctive and less common choice outside of Armenian communities.
